#c241d9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c241d9 is composed of 76.1% red, 25.5% green and 85.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.6% cyan, 70%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 290.9 degrees, a saturation of 66.7% and a lightness of 55.3%. #c241d9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ff82ff with #8500b3.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#c241d9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050106 is the darkest color, while #fcf5f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#c241d9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#918793 is the less saturated color, while #da1efc is the most saturated one.
